Overview
- Description
- This collection includes approximately 12,000 personal case files containing information on Jews trying to immigrate to Australia as well as family search files from the Archives of the Australian Jewish Welfare and Relief Society (AJWRS) (now Jewish Care) between 1946 and 1954. Also included is correspondence with Jewish organizations, such as HIAS (the Hebrew Immigrant Aid Society) and the Joint (American Jewish Joint Distribution Committee), as well as with the Federal Immigration Department, and included are 3,036 AJWRS registration cards, a collection of scrapbooks including newspaper articles, circulars kept by the United Jewish Overseas Relief Fund and the Australian Jewish Welfare and Relief Society.

- Biography
-
On March 18, 1936, the German Jewish Refugee’s Fund was established which would later become the Australian Jewish Welfare Society, Jewish Community Services, and today Jewish Care.

- Provenance
- On March 18, 1936, the German Jewish Refugee’s Fund was established which would later become the Australian Jewish Welfare Society, Jewish Community Services and today Jewish Care who currently administers the records.The United States Holocaust Memorial Museum International Archives Project Division received the microfilmed collection from Jewish Care Incorporated in August 2005. The collection was transferred to the United States Holocaust Memorial Museum Archives in August 2005.
